For me, these ChatGPT-generated essays have a certain ChatGPT-style so that once you're accustomed to such essays, it's not that difficult (for a human) to tell whether an essay is ChatGPT-generated or not. (For example, they like to beat about the bush; they like to talk around an issue instead of developing a thesis; they like to finish with a play-safe counterpoint.) But then that will probably be ChatGPT's next mission - to rid itself of its ChatGPT style.
